Pretty good, but needs some work.

For your very first game in flash, I am very impressed. I don't even want to mension my first game...

The good points:
*The hit tests were surprisingly good. During the trip down the river, I was just expecting to lose due to crappy hitTests. I don't know if you used hitTest with bounding boxes or not, but you made it fair enough.
*The game play was well thought out. Getting each item and using them to solve problems. I also like the boss and the minigame you threw in there. Changes the pace a little bit. And since Ive never played Zelda before, I don't really know what everyone else is talking about. But even if I did, it still should not bring down your rating as it is an excellent game. There are tons of tributes/rips out there that have gotten great reviews.
*The control style was also well thought up. I really liked how you kept everything to the keyboard. This is something that game developers need to take care of more often. If a game utilizes the mouse, then the navigation can include the mouse. However, if a game is keyboard controlled, so should the navigation (and the inventory). This way, the players does not need to change back and forth.

Things that need work:
*Definately speed up the character. Or at least add a run feature. As others have said, it was a little frustrating to have to walk back and forth at such a slow pace.

I can't believe this got such a low score

Graphics: Amazing. The animations are very smooth the effects were just sweet.
Game Play: Nice, but as others have said, too many things to think about. Maybe only have 3 or 2 keys, and you can do combos (more possibilites that way). The opponent also moves way too fast to keep up.
I really liked all of the options, and how you can unlock secrets.
Great job man.

arayh responds:

Actually, I wanted to have fewer buttons too, but keyboards have a problem when you press more than two or three keys at once. This causes problems in multiplayer mode. Thanks for the suggestions though. :)
